Intel Core i7-8650U testing with a LENOVO 20LFCTA1WW (N25ET54W 1.40 BIOS) and Intel UHD 620 3GB on openSUSE 20200806 via the Phoronix Test Suite.
Intel Core i7-8650U
Processor: Intel Core i7-8650U @ 4.20GHz (4 Cores / 8 Threads), Motherboard: LENOVO 20LFCTA1WW (N25ET54W 1.40 BIOS), Chipset: Intel Xeon E3-1200 v6/7th, Memory: 16GB, Disk: 512GB SAMSUNG MZVLB512HAJQ-000L7, Graphics: Intel UHD 620 3GB (1150MHz), Audio: Realtek ALC285, Monitor: DUAL-DVI, Network: Intel I219-LM + Intel 8265 / 8275
OS: openSUSE 20200806, Kernel: 5.7.11-1-default (x86_64), Desktop: GNOME Shell 3.36.4, Display Server: X Server 1.20.8 + Wayland, Display Driver: modesetting 1.20.8, OpenGL: 4.6 Mesa 20.1.4, Compiler: GCC 10.2.1 20200728 [revision c0438ced53bcf57e4ebb1c38c226e41571aca892], File-System: btrfs, Screen Resolution: 4160x1440
Compiler Notes: --build=x86_64-suse-linux --disable-libcc1 --disable-libssp --disable-libstdcxx-pch --disable-libvtv --disable-werror --enable-cet --enable-checking=release --enable-gnu-indirect-function --enable-languages=c,c++,objc,fortran,obj-c++,ada,go,d --enable-libphobos --enable-libstdcxx-allocator=new --enable-link-mutex --enable-linux-futex --enable-multilib --enable-offload-targets=hsa,nvptx-none=/usr/nvptx-none,amdgcn-amdhsa=/usr/amdgcn-amdhsa, --enable-plugin --enable-ssp --enable-version-specific-runtime-libs --host=x86_64-suse-linux --mandir=/usr/share/man --with-arch-32=x86-64 --with-build-config=bootstrap-lto-lean --with-gcc-major-version-only --with-slibdir=/lib64 --with-tune=generic --without-cuda-driver --without-system-libunwind
Processor Notes: Scaling Governor: intel_pstate powersave - CPU Microcode: 0xd6
Python Notes: Python 2.7.18 + Python 3.8.4
Security Notes: itlb_multihit: KVM: Mitigation of Split huge pages + l1tf: Mitigation of PTE Inversion; VMX: conditional cache flushes SMT vulnerable + mds: Mitigation of Clear buffers; SMT vulnerable + meltdown: Mitigation of PTI + spec_store_bypass: Mitigation of SSB disabled via prctl and seccomp + spectre_v1: Mitigation of usercopy/swapgs barriers and __user pointer sanitization + spectre_v2: Mitigation of Full generic retpoline IBPB: conditional IBRS_FW STIBP: conditional RSB filling + srbds: Mitigation of Microcode + tsx_async_abort: Mitigation of Clear buffers; SMT vulnerable
